New analytical forms of a deuteron wave function for potentials of the Nijmegen group
Description
To approximate the deuteron wave function in coordinate representation two new analytical forms were proposed . They are represented as the product of the power function r n for the sum of exponential terms Ai·exp(-ai·r3). For realistic phenomenological potentials of the Nijmegen group these forms are constructed as deuteron wave function in the coordinate representation, which do not contain superfluous knots. The calculated parameters of the deuteron compared with experimental and theoretical data are compared
